'Shine on You Crazy Diamond' always reminds me of the Hillsborough disaster in 1989. I used to go to see my football team in those days and stood on the awful terracing that made up Scotlands football stadiums (when it was still only about £3-£5 to get in) and can remember getting caught up in the crowd at the Scottish Cup final in 1988 when my team equalised, we were moved up by about 15 steps by the crowd, as I am only 5 feet tall it was pretty scary but there was enough room for the crowd to move like this and not get crushed as there were no cages at the front, unlike Hillsborough, so when the disaster happened 10 1/2 months later it really affected me and things relating to it stuck in my mind. If I remember correctly one young Liverpool supporter's coffin was carried out of his house, which had all it's windows open so that the song could be heard, to 'Shine on You Crazy Diamond' playing on the house stereo and cranked up to full blast. Whenever I hear it I think of him and his family and cry.

He was also drugged up, losing sanity, unable to control himself, emotionally incapacitated, agreed to leave the band because he was unable to perform duties...

He since worked on solo albums The Madcap Laughs, Opel, The Radio One Sessions, Barrett, and some best ofs...

Years after he quit the band Syd showed up at the studio looking nothing like his former self. Roger didn't even recognize him. He was chubby, bald, and completely zombie-like: showing the drugs effects physically as well as emotionally.

Lately, it is rumored that he is dead. Naww. His limelight hasn't shone for many years because he likes it that way. He couldn't handle that kind of attention anymore, he's just an introverted hermit who prefers to live away from civilization.

He is schizophrenic....also rumored that it is the effect of Lysergic Acid Diethylamide. Not necessarily although it's probable. An extended use of such a drug will warp your brain so badly that you're no longer the same person, obviously, however since no person's brain is the same the effects would be different: example: with Syd Barrett who had the tendancy for emotional instability, and Timothy Leary who used the drug for 30 years with the result of loss of intelligence rather than loss of sanity.
